Are you a seasoned Multi Skilled Maintenance Engineer within the food manufacturing space? If so, this opportunity might be perfect for you! We are currently seeking individuals with time served maintenance skills to join Henderson Brown Contract Division.

Responsibilities:

  • Efficiently repair various production machinery using both reactive and preventative maintenance techniques, including motors, control panels and various systems.
  • Confidence with PLC fault finding.
  • Demonstrate proficiency in both electrical and mechanical principles.
  • Ensure compliance with health and safety regulations.
  • Collaborate with the production team to optimise equipment performance and minimise downtime.
  • Keep detailed records of maintenance activities and provide reports as needed.

Requirements:

  • Previous experience in the FMCG sector.
  • Relevant qualifications in electrical or mechanical engineering (BTEC, HNC, etc.).
  • Possession of an 18th edition or any additional electrical qualifications is highly desirable.
  • Strong problem-solving skills and the ability to work under pressure.
  • Excellent communication and teamwork abilities.
